Output 3324b6b2e2c405cf1c00db7d7fb8ac95a3f945fb57b852fe5980c5c87c014872:2

value
1388162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93f81d3013fe435d9ae88471b6612429be303bb OP_EQUAL
address
3MVidiuquNkkL2dr9KXAjAbUXY6MgC46jN
transaction
3324b6b2e2c405cf1c00db7d7fb8ac95a3f945fb57b852fe5980c5c87c014872